Board Certified Behavior Analyst (BCBA) – Contract 

SPANISH SPEAKING IS A MUST

$100–$110/hour | Flexible Scheduling | Clinician-Led Support


LBAPS (Licensed Behavior Analyst Professional Services, PLLC) is seeking a highly dependable, experienced BCBA who takes full ownership of their cases and consistently delivers high-quality, ethical care.

If you’re looking to step away from high-volume environments where quality is compromised—and instead work with a team that respects your clinical judgment, values consistency, and prioritizes meaningful outcomes—this is that opportunity.


Why This Role Stands Out:

At LBAPS, you’re not treated as interchangeable. Your clinical voice matters, your time is respected, and your work is measured by real client progress—not caseload volume. We’re intentional about who we bring on. This role is best suited for clinicians who are organized, accountable, and committed to maintaining a high standard of care without the need for constant oversight.


What You’ll Do:

  • Lead the full clinical lifecycle of your cases, from assessment through ongoing treatment
  • Conduct comprehensive assessments and develop individualized, data-driven Behavior Intervention Plans (BIPs)
  • Oversee implementation of treatment plans to ensure consistency and clinical integrity
  • Provide structured supervision, mentorship, and accountability to BTs/RBTs
  • Analyze client data regularly and make timely, informed program adjustments
  • Deliver clear, actionable parent training to support long-term success
  • Maintain accurate, timely documentation in alignment with compliance standards

What You Bring;

  • Master’s degree in Applied Behavior Analysis or a related field
  • Active BCBA certification in good standing with the BACB (required)
  • 2–3 years of hands-on ABA experience with children in behavioral health or special education
  • Proven ability to manage a caseload independently and meet deadlines consistently
  • Strong clinical judgment, attention to detail, and data analysis skills
  • Professional, proactive communication style with both families and team members
  • Ability to lead, mentor, and hold others accountable to clinical standards
  • Bilingual in Spanish Required
